BREAKING NEWS: Chloe Malle has just been appointed the new head of editorial content at American Vogue, following the stepping down of Dame Anna Wintour from her daily editorial role. While Wintour will continue to oversee Vogue globally and serve as chief content officer for Conde Nast, Malle’s appointment marks a significant shift in the magazine’s leadership.
Malle, daughter of actress Candice Bergen and French director Louis Malle, will assume her new responsibilities immediately. Previously, she served as the editor of Vogue.com and co-hosted the popular fashion and culture podcast, The Run-Through. Her new role will involve leading the creative and editorial vision of the iconic publication, reporting directly to Wintour.
Malle expressed her excitement over the new role, stating, “Fashion and media are both evolving at breakneck speed, and I am so thrilled – and awed – to be part of that. I also feel incredibly fortunate to still have Anna just down the hall as my mentor.”
In her announcement, Wintour emphasized the importance of this transition, saying, “Fashion is the art of embracing change, but some changes run closer to one’s heart than the rest.” Wintour highlighted Malle’s exceptional capabilities, calling her “a voracious, engaged journalist with an intuition for women’s changing interests,” and praised her understanding of the broader impact of fashion beyond the runway.
